Take, for instance, the Badlands Guardian located near Medicine Hat, Alberta, Canada. Seen best via satellite imagery, this geological marvel appears uncannily similar to a person wearing headphones, inviting playful interpretations about extraterrestrial visitors leaving cryptic messages behind.
